Most of these games are simply incompatible with the NT5 kernel coding. The NT5 kernel prevents direct access to hardware, games require it... Installing Service Pack 1 may help a bit. I hear there is improved compatibility with it...
In any event, you can always try and boot with a bootfloppy, into DOS... Load the correct drivers, and use the command prompt to start the game. The games you mention were meant to run under DOS anyway if I recall corectly. ... Time has no bearing... ...when the whiteout begins...
